Comic Book Store Details
The Comic Stop located in Watertown, Massachusetts is a cozy and welcoming comic book shop that offers an impressive selection of comics, with people who visit this comic shop consistently praising its well-curated collection of both new releases and back issues, creating an inviting atmosphere where comic enthusiasts can browse comfortably through their extensive inventory.
This comic shop maintains a robust collection of graphic novels and trade paperbacks, with dedicated shelves specifically for children and teens, making it particularly appealing for readers of all ages who enjoy longer-format comic storytelling, and visitors often mention the great deals available on graphic novel purchases.

How much do things cost here?
People who visit this comic shop frequently comment on the reasonable pricing structure, with many noting that the prices are particularly competitive for a store located just outside Boston, and some visitors even mention receiving welcome discounts during their first visit.

Collectibles & Action Figures
This comic book store offers a variety of collectibles including Funko Pops and toys, with the shop maintaining a diverse selection that caters to collectors of various interests.
Trading Cards, Manga, Anime & More
Beyond comics, this shop has established itself as a destination for Magic: The Gathering enthusiasts, offering both cards and accessories, while also maintaining a selection of Funko Pops for collectors.
The store carries manga titles among its diverse inventory, adding another layer of variety to its comic book offerings.
